12 HOUR Emergency Services

  • Country: USA
  • State: Virginia
  • City: Newport News
  • Address: Newport News, VA 23607, USA
  • Store
Phone number
More companies in your city
It's Just A Drain

3501 Warwick Blvd, Newport News, VA 23607, USA

  • 5 reviews
A Hampton Roads Plumbing & Sewer

5874 Jefferson Ave, Newport News, VA 23605, USA

  • 3 reviews
Hogge's Septic Tank Services LLC

37 Church Rd, Newport News, VA 23606, USA

  • 1 reviews
Campbell's Plumbing

504 Frank Ln, Newport News, VA 23606, USA

Added comment